Output 557708e152c1f1f588c371653cd38420da80e72609d0e2f821391a25fbfcd19e:1

value
2134480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5b82cdf304d65cd9ba4d8c22dff344ea5af822 OP_EQUAL
address
3DD8h1Mqb2rDEjqsge72MwwC5PsTeSaztA
transaction
557708e152c1f1f588c371653cd38420da80e72609d0e2f821391a25fbfcd19e
spent
true